A generalized character related to the local structure and representation theory of a finite group

Abstract

We consider the generalized character Ψ1,p,G\Psi_{1,p,G} of a finite group GG which vanishes on all pp-singular elements of GG and whose value at each pp-regular yGy \in G is the number of pp-elements of CG(y)C_{G}(y). We conjecture that this is always a character, and may be afforded by a projective RGRG-module, where RR is an appropriate complete discrete valuation ring whose residue field has characteristic pp. We examine a number of case where this is the case, and consider consequences for the representation theory and character theory of GG when this conjecture is known to hold. In particular, we prove, among other things, that the conjecture is valid for all primes pp in the case that GPSL(2,q)G \cong {\rm PSL}(2,q) or SL(2,q){\rm SL}(2,q) for every prime power qq.
